    MPT-AES Determination of Phosphorus in Cross-linked Starch

    • Phosphorus in cross-linked starch sample was determined by microwave plasma torch (MPT)-AES,using argon as the working and carrier gas and oxygen as the shielding gas.It was shown that acidity of testing sample solution should be kept below 0.03 mol·L-1,and that co-existing Na+-ion should be removed from the starch sample by washing to eliminate its interference.Under the optimized conditions,it was found that highest sensitivity and intensity were attained by choosing the analytical spectral line of 253.565 nm,and by working at the flowrate of 1.5 and 0.27 L·min-1 for the carrier gas and working gas.Detection limit (3S/N) found for the method was 0.02 μg·L-1.By parallel analysis of cross-linked starch sample for its phosphours content by the present method and by ICP-AES,consistent analytical results and values of RSD′s (n=5) were obtained.It was proved that the MPT-AES was feasible to be used for less energy consumption and lower operation cost as compared with ICP-AES.
